> Viewing block matrices "nicely" seems to be difficult in Sage.
>
> sage: A=matrix([[1]])
> sage: B=matrix([[2]])
> sage: C=matrix([[3]])
> sage: D=matrix([[4]])
> sage: BM=block_matrix([A,B,C,D])
> sage: BM
>
> [1|2]
> [-+-]
> [3|4]
>
> Okay, this is fine but a little clunky.  Let's try something nicer:
> sage: show(BM)
> Upon which a dvi viewer opens up, unfortunately not a very nice one...
> and shows the block matrix with only a vertical dividing line, not a
> horizontal one!
>
> Okay, let's try the notebook:
> {{{id=0|
> A=matrix([[1]])
> B=matrix([[2]])
> C=matrix([[3]])
> D=matrix([[4]])
> ///
>
> }}}
>
> {{{id=1|
> BM=block_matrix([A,B,C,D]);BM
> ///
>
> [1|2]
> [-+-]
> [3|4]}}}
>
> So far so good, but when I click "Typeset" to get a LaTeXed matrix...
>
> {{{id=1|
> BM=block_matrix([A,B,C,D]);BM
> ///
>
> <html><span class="math">\left(\begin{array}{r|r}
> 1 & 2 \\
> 3 & 4
> \end{array}\right)</span></html>
>
> }}}
>
> Which as you can see does NOT have any "blockiness" to it at all.
> Very pretty, but not a block matrix, at least not identifiably so.
>
> But is this a bug?  I'm not sure, as there might be good reasons for
> these viewing options I am not aware of.  If it is, I'll be happy to
> post a trac ticket.
